Description
Birmingham City University award for the provision of the Occupational Health for Students. A Professional and Confidential Student Health Screening and Inoculation Service using the Open procedure in accordance with the requirements of the Procurement Act 2023 (PA23) . The University reserves the right to refine any specific award criteria during the Procurement Process (in accordance with section 24 of the Act)

Participation
Conditions suppliers must meet to bid.
Potential Bidders should also be able to demonstrate if offered award of contract the following insurance levels: Insurance Minimum Level of Insurance Public Liability Insurance - £10M for each and every incident Product Liability Insurance - £10m for each and every incident Professional Indemnity Insurance - £5M for each and every incident Bidders, and those connected persons and sub contractors involved in delivery of the contract should not be excluded suppliers for mandatory exclusions on the debarment list within the UK. Employer's Liability Insurance - Minimum statutory limit (£10M) as laid down by legislation. Bidders are required to complete a PSQ as part of the process. TUPE considerations will apply as part of this award.
Please refer to section 10 of the specification Appendix A referring to accreditations and qualifications.
